systemd.service 手册
时间: 2023-08-04 07:00:53 浏览: 57
systemd.service是一个手册,用于指导和解释systemd服务的使用方法和配置选项。systemd是一个Linux系统的初始化系统和服务管理器,它负责启动和停止系统中的各个服务。systemd.service手册详细描述了如何创建和配置系统服务。
systemd.service手册包含了关于服务配置文件的结构和语法的说明。对于每个服务,都需要创建一个对应的.service文件。手册提供了创建该文件所需的基本信息和格式要求。手册中还介绍了各种配置选项,包括服务的描述、启动类型、依赖关系、执行路径、环境变量和资源限制等等。了解这些选项可以帮助管理员正确配置服务,以满足系统的需求。
此外,systemd.service手册还介绍了如何管理服务。手册中列出了一些常用的命令和操作,如启动、停止、重启、重载和查询服务状态等。手册还提供了一些示例和最佳实践,以帮助用户更好地使用systemd服务管理器。
总之,systemd.service手册对于理解和使用systemd服务至关重要。通过阅读手册,管理员可以学习到如何正确配置和管理系统服务,以提高系统的可维护性和稳定性。手册不仅提供了必要的语法和选项说明,还为用户提供了实际应用的示例和建议。这使得管理员能够更加灵活地使用systemd服务,以满足各种需求。
相关问题
Created symlink from /etc/systemd/system/multi-user.target.wants/httpd.service to /usr/lib/systemd/system/httpd.service.
这是一个创建符号链接的命令,它将/etc/systemd/system/multi-user.target.wants/目录下的httpd.service符号链接到/usr/lib/systemd/system/httpd.service文件。这个命令的作用是将httpd服务添加到系统启动项中,以便在系统启动时自动启动httpd服务。如果您想了解更多关于符号链接的信息,可以使用以下命令查看man手册:
```shell
man ln
```
linux中service和systemctl
service和systemctl都是用于管理系统服务的命令,但在不同的Linux发行版中可能会有所区别。
1. service命令:service命令是早期系统使用的一种服务管理工具,它通常与init系统一起使用。您可以使用service命令启动、停止、重启或查询系统服务的状态。例如,要启动Apache服务,可以使用以下命令:`service apache2 start`。
2. systemctl命令:systemctl是较新的系统服务管理工具,通常与systemd init系统一起使用。systemd是现代Linux发行版中普遍采用的init系统。您可以使用systemctl命令来管理系统服务,包括启动、停止、重启、重新加载配置和查询服务状态等。例如,要启动Apache服务,可以使用以下命令:`systemctl start apache2.service`。
在较新的Linux发行版中,systemctl命令更为常用,因为它提供了更多功能和灵活性。但在某些旧版或特定的Linux发行版中,可能仍然使用service命令来管理系统服务。
请注意,具体的命令和服务名称可能因Linux发行版和版本而异。因此,在使用这些命令时,请参考您所使用的Linux发行版的官方文档或手册。